There are longstanding surveillance systems in place that help implement laws at brick-and-mortar stores, but we do not have a system in place for online retailers, Leas said, adding, The results of this study highlight the need for greater oversight and enforcement of online tobacco retailers. A top official at the Vapor Technology Assn., a trade group for the e-cigarette industry, said the study raised an academic issue that is interesting, but not particularly relevant to what is really happening in this country with respect to youth and vaping products. Tony Abboud, the associations executive director, said vaping by youth has plummeted since the age to purchase these products was raised to 21 in 2019
